WebAdvertising your shop. Whatever the characteristics of your shop, you must make sure that your potential customers know about you and the range of goods you offer. Word of mouth recommendation is very effective but can be a slow process. You may need to promote your shop by advertising to your potential customers. Ensure that the name resonates well … member checking in qualitative research pdfWebSep 7, 2024 · Providing accommodation, such as a bed and breakfast or camping ground. Growing non-food crops e.g. flowers or flax. Rearing certain species of goats, rabbits, sheep or alpacas for their wool.
